I can't open my zip archive

The most common problems with zip archives occur during file transfer. If you want to send a zip archive (ie, any file created by ZipIt) then your terminal software should be set to send in Binary, but not MacBinary mode.

In ZTerm, this can be achieved by choosing Binary from the Transfer Convert submenu in the File menu. Similarly, when receiving a zip archive (ie, a file that ends in '.zip', created by PKZip or some similar program, including ZipIt) you should be in either Binary or MacBinary mode, but not text mode.
